有没有更好的 mplayer 命令行界面,或者其他好的 CLI 音乐播放器?

有没有更好的 mplayer 命令行界面,或者其他好的 CLI 音乐播放器?

我通常更喜欢在命令行上执行操作。Mplayer 是一款出色的工具,可用于播放各种媒体,但命令行界面很糟糕。我希望在 CLI 媒体播放器中看到以下功能:

  • 清晰的输出——易于理解,不会被一堆与日常使用无关的内容所扰乱
  • ID3 信息
  • 进度条和播放时间信息(总时间、当前时间、剩余时间)
  • 播放队列 - 包含歌曲长度的列表,并显示您当前播放到的位置

答案1

我决定使用mpd(Music Player Daemon),以及一个名为 的 CLI 界面ncmpcpp。这种组合效果很好,并且有一些出色的配套应用程序可以执行诸如音频录制 ( mpdscribble) 和使用媒体按钮控制它 ( indimpc) 之类的操作。它可能不像 那样轻量级mplayer,但感觉平衡性很好。

另一个值得注意的 CLI 媒体播放器是,尽管我使用它的次数较少herrie。它具有我在原始问题中概述的所有功能,并且非常轻巧。

答案2

查看cmus

来自维基百科文章:

cmus(C* 音乐播放器)是一个适用于类 Unix 操作系统的小型、快速的控制台音频播放器。cmus 是根据 GNU 通用公共许可证(GPL)的条款分发的,并且仅通过使用 ncurses 构建的纯文本界面进行操作。

我用它来听我图书馆里的随机歌曲。不过,对于大多数用途来说,mplayer对我来说就足够了。例如-playlist,帮助等选项。如果您发现数量太多/太少,-shuffle您还可以细化数量并为输出着色。mplayer

答案3

虽然我不确定它是否有用,但你检查过 vlc 命令行吗?我没有用过它,但当涉及到高质量播放时,我会使用 VLC,它应该可以完成你使用 mplayer 所做的大部分事情(如果不是全部的话)。

http://www.videolan.org/doc/vlc-user-guide/en/ch04.html

答案4

MPS--基于 bash 的 mplayer 从属模式前端。

git 克隆https://github.com/sshpass/mps

相关内容